A Night For The Underdogs

11/03/2014 at 10:42am EST

from Craig Custance of ESPN,

We loved this note on Twitter on Sunday night from Lightning digital media guru Andrew DeWitt: A $100 parlay bet on the Sabres, Flames, Coyotes and Hurricanes to all win on Sunday would have paid off $5,755. Somehow, all four of those teams managed to win, once again proving that on any given night in the NHL, any team can win.

That said, it seems like the parity that NHL commissioner Gary Bettman loves so much isn't quite as widespread as it has been in the past. We'll blame Connor McDavid for that.

But it was good to see Carolina win again for new coach Bill Peters, who has been dealt an ugly hand at the start of his head-coaching career. If there was any doubt he came from the Mike Babcock coaching tree, it was erased when he once again sat Alexander Semin in favor of a lineup he called honest and hard-working. The wins may not be plentiful early on in Carolina, but that doesn't mean messages can't be sent and received.
